Buick Roadmaster 1994 Description

1994 Buick Roadmaster Estate Wagon 125k miles with the LT1 5.7 V8 - 260hp / 330 tq
Rear end has been upgraded to an Auburn Posi unit with 4.10 gears in 2015. ABS light is on because with these gears you lose the tone wheel in the rear so ABS is inop.
4L60E transmission was replaced in this car back in 2015 from a vehicle listed with 18k miles on it, vehicle had already had a reman AC Delco transmission installed so it has even less miles than that on it. Installed deep transmission pan.
P235/70R15 front tires, P275/60R15 rear tires on Halibrand wheels (look identical to Torque Thrusts).
Hypertech Programmer power tune installed and was needed to change tire size in PCM due to tire size change. Shift points also changed for better performance.
Hypertech 160 degree thermostat installed.
Factory mechanical fan removed and 2nd electric fan installed.
Air Pump and all emission tubing removed. Plugs installed in both manifolds.
Both air intake resonators removed, they call this a first base and home plate delete.
K&N Air filter in factory housing, housing opened up for more air.
H.I.D. headlamps.
VATS key bypassed with resistor.
2" Lowering springs all the way around, Air Lift air bags in rear springs.
Factory dual exhaust with cats removed and mufflers replaced with Rush Performance mufflers.
Minor exhaust leak at the rh manifold to front pipe.
Interior is in good condition, no major tears anywhere. One tiny puncture in drivers seat.
Brand new correct floor mats w/snaps. Not some cheap universal ones.
Trim piece missing on drivers door panel, panel has crack.
RR window inop, switch is broken in up position, may only need switch which i have.
Headliner in very good condition.
Factory cassette radio, electric antenna works.
Missing rear wiper arm.
Some rust on rear 1/4's, especially on rh side, bottom of spare tire well is gone.
Dent at front of passenger door, and larger dent on passenger rear 1/4 panel.
Floors and doors are all solid.
Glass is all good.
I have a replacement trim piece for the passenger 1/4 if it was to be repaired.
Much of the vinyl woodgrain on the moldings are peeling off which is very common.
One of the mounting points for the grille is broken, otherwise chrome is in very good condition.
New front brakes installed earlier this year.
New sway bar links installed this month.
New coolant temp sensor for gauge in dash installed last month.
A/C in need of a recharge.
Check engine light on for O2 sensor.
Oil cooler lines were leaking, swapped oil filter adapter for a vehicle without oil cooler lines and plugged off lines up by radiator.
Oil leak at rear of intake manifold, very common on LT1's.
Car has been on synthetic oil since purchasing it in 2014. Only put 3k miles on it in that time.
Car has gone as fast as 14.67 @ 93 in the 1/4 mile @ Lebanon Valley Dragway in Sept 2016.
Finished in 3rd place in Street Eliminator @ Lebanon Valley Dragway this year with one race win.
Runs and drives great, just took it on a 150 mile drive this past weekend.
